在 2026 年,WordPress 网站搬家已不再是简单的文件移动,而是一场关于数据一致性、SSL 安全性及多语言 SEO 权重分配的系统工程。如果操作不当,不仅会导致网站长时间宕机,更可能触发搜索引擎的权重惩罚。
作为一名实测过 50 款主流 VPS 厂家的开发者,我深知迁移过程中的痛点。本文将从硬核技术的角度,拆解如何在不损失流量的前提下,将 WordPress 快速迁移至新服务器,并针对网络线路进行深度优化。
服务器选型:搬家是为了更好的“网络底座”
搬家的第一步是选对目标服务器。在 2026 年,线路质量直接决定了 SEO 的“起跑线”。
🚀 2026 推荐建站线路对比表
专家视点: 如果你追求性价比且目标用户主要集中在联通/移动用户,AS4837 线路是首选;若预算充足且需兼顾电信用户的极致延迟,则应选择纯正的 CN2 GIA。
迁移前置:5 分钟配置清单
在动用数据库之前,请务必完成以下标准化操作,以确保迁移过程的平滑:
- DNS TTL 预调优: 提前 24 小时将域名的 TTL 值修改为 600。当迁移完成并更新 IP 时,较低的 TTL 值能显著缩短 DNS 全球生效的周期,从而减少访问中断。
- 全量数据快照: 无论使用何种控制面板(如 1Panel 或宝塔),必须生成一个包含物理文件与
.sql文件的完整压缩包。 - 软件环境一致性核对:
- PHP: 建议采用 PHP 8.1 或更高版本以获得最佳性能。
- 数据库: 推荐 MySQL 8.0 或兼容的 MariaDB 10.6+ 版本。
三大核心搬家方案:从插件到命令行
1. 全自动化插件方案(适合 2GB 内存以下 VPS)
使用 All-in-One WP Migration 或 Duplicator 插件。
- 适用场景: 网站数据小于 2GB,且不具备 SSH 经验的用户。
- 技术细节: 插件会自动处理数据库中的静态路径序列化问题,降低了数据库报错风险。
2. 面板一键迁移(高效批量方案)
对于安装了主流管理面板(如宝塔、1Panel)的服务器,可以直接利用其自带的 API 迁移工具。
- 操作逻辑: 输入新旧服务器的 API Key,面板会自动完成数据打包、内网传输及环境配置。
3. SSH + SCP 手动迁移(极客与高性能方案)
如果你追求极致的传输效率,通过 SSH 命令行可以直接在两个服务器间建立高速加密通道,避免走本地宽带中转:
# 在旧服务器上执行,将网站目录直接拉取到新服务器
scp -P 22 -r /www/wwwroot/yourdomain.com root@新服务器IP:/www/wwwroot/数据库处理:迁移后的“换血”操作
搬家后如果更换了域名,最常见的错误是页面链接依然指向旧地址或导致 404。你需要通过 SQL 命令精准替换数据库中的路径。
⚠️ 执行前请务必备份数据库! 进入 PHPMyAdmin 或命令行运行以下 SQL(注意将前缀 wp_ 替换为你的实际表前缀):
UPDATE wp_options SET option_value = replace(option_value, '老域名', '新域名') WHERE option_name = 'home' OR option_name = 'siteurl';
UPDATE wp_posts SET post_content = replace(post_content, '老域名', '新域名');
UPDATE wp_postmeta SET meta_value = replace(meta_value, '老域名', '新域名');全球化权重保护:hreflang 与 SSL 部署
1. hreflang 代码检查示例
根据多语言分发 SOP,迁移完成后必须验证 hreflang 架构的完整性。确保你的 <head> 标签中包含以下代码逻辑,以引导搜索引擎定位对应语言版本,防止被判为重复内容:
<link rel="alternate" hreflang="en-US" href="https://yourdomain.com/en/" />
<link rel="alternate" hreflang="zh-CN" href="https://yourdomain.com/zh/" />
<link rel="alternate" hreflang="x-default" href="https://yourdomain.com/" />2. 线路检测与 BBR 优化
迁移至新 VPS 后,利用以下命令开启内核 BBR 加速,可显著优化在 AS4837 或普通 163 线路上高并发访问时的丢包率:
echo "net.core.default_qdisc=fq" >> /etc/sysctl.conf
echo "net.ipv4.tcp_congestion_control=bbr" >> /etc/sysctl.conf
sysctl -p💡 vps1111 避坑指南:资深站长的迁移心得
💡 迁移后的关键性审计清单:
- 文件权限审计: 确保目录权限为 755,文件为 644,用户组归属于
www或www-data,防止图片上传失败。 - 伪静态检查: Nginx 环境下请务必重新加载 WordPress 的伪静态规则(重置一次固定链接),否则内页会大面积报 404。
- 线路实测: 利用
mtr或nexttrace命令跟踪回程,确认电信/联通是否符合预期的 AS4837 或 CN2 GIA 路由走向。 - SSL 证书: 迁移后及时申请新证书(推荐 Let’s Encrypt),避免浏览器拦截导致访客跳出,彻底毁掉 SEO 排名。
总结
WordPress 搬家不是单纯的代码挪窝,而是对网站生存环境的一次全面升级。通过选择优质的 AS4837/CN2 GIA 线路,并辅以严格的数据库替换和 SEO 权重保护操作,你的网站可以在平滑迁移后实现访问速度与自然搜索权重的双重飞跃。
